| 正面描述 | The obverse features a reproduction of the central scene from Salvador Dalí's painting 'Autorretrato con l'Humanité' (1923), in which the artist depicts himself dressed as a worker in a provocative, confrontational pose reflecting his admiration for the revolutionary ideas of his era. The composition is rendered in high relief against a stippled field, faithful to the original artwork's bold figurative style. The legend 'ESPAÑA' appears in the upper field, accompanied by the artist's name 'DALÍ' and the date '2009'. |

| 背面描述 | The reverse presents a faithful reproduction of Dalí's work 'Automatic Start of a Gala Portrait' (1932), in which the artist explores the successive compositional stages of an image, reflecting his Surrealist experimentation with perception and form. The portrait of Gala is rendered in layered, fragmented planes characteristic of Dalí's early Surrealist period. The legend 'PINTORES ESPAÑOLES' arcs across the field, accompanied by the mint mark 'M' and the face value inscription '10 EURO'. |
